**FAQ: What do I do if the Quillhaven catalogue import stalls?**

The nightly import pulls MARC records from the Brindlemoor consortium feed into our Shelfwright catalogue. If it stalls past 03:00, it's almost always the dedupe stage waiting on a lock. Restart the import worker first; don't touch the queue. If the worker won't start because the credentials store is sealed — that happens after host patching — you'll need to unseal it manually. The passphrase for unsealing is listed just below this entry.

vault phrase of hahop-badug = novvan-ulaion-zorius-noviel-gorwyn-casix-tamys

Handover — Discount Policy, Large Deals

For heads of department. Current rule: anything over 20% on Vantrell Suite deals needs my sign-off; Odette inherits that authority Monday. Two exceptions pending (Greywick and Ashforth accounts). Hold the line on multi-year stacking. Context on where this policy is heading sits below.

confidential, bahap-bajog: Zorethix Works is in early talks to buy Kelethox Foods for about $30.7 million. The Ralvan launch date is September 19, and nothing goes to the press before then.

## Authentication

RatePeek, the hotel rate-parity checker, authenticates against the internal ParityCore service. Every scrape-and-compare job must include the service key in its request header; unauthenticated calls are rejected. Keys are scoped per environment, so do not reuse the staging key in production. For this week's sync build, the ParityCore key is listed below.

service key, kawip-kahop: kto4_QQzB

Scope: the Garrowmont occupancy feed for the Pellidrome parking structures. Feed publishes stall counts every 30s over mTLS from edge counters to the Stallwatch aggregator. No PII transits the pipeline; counts only. Review targets: cert rotation, replay protection, and the signed-manifest check on counter firmware. Read access to the staging aggregator is granted via the reviewer vault. Audit logs are immutable for 90 days. To open the reviewer vault for the first time, enter the recovery passphrase shown below.

recovery phrase for fajeg-hagug: holox-fenmir

Runbook: DeployBot account recovery (Quillhaven on-call). If DeployBot stops posting deploy status to #ship-room, check its service account. If locked, trigger recovery from the Braxton admin panel, select "bot identity," and confirm the channel binding. When prompted by the recovery flow, enter the passphrase exactly as shown below.

recovery phrase for bawep-kawef: oliath-casdor